Wolves: Bolton`s Feeder Club?

Bolton Wanderers have signed central defender Mark Conolly from Wolverhampton Wanderers, for a fee which could rise to around £1 million, if he does something outrageous, like become a first team regular. He is presumably, the young player who was mentioned by Gary Megson, when quizzed toward the end of the transfer window. The news has yet to be announced officially.

‘Bolton Tie Up Wolves Youngster` is the unfortunate headline on another Wanderers site. Lads, you need to get yourselves a proof reader.

Conolly is the third escapee from the Black Country to pitch up at the Reebok, following Chris Evans and Mark Davies. One hopes that the trend doesn`t continue to include Mick McCarthy when the Whites are recruiting their next manager.
